Comprehending Commercial Windows
Commercial windows are designed to hold up against the rigors of high traffic and differing weather conditions. They are generally larger and more robust than domestic windows, typically featuring customized products and finishes to enhance durability and energy efficiency. These windows can be made from various materials, consisting of aluminum, steel, and composite materials, each with its own set of benefits and upkeep requirements.
Common Issues with Commercial WindowsBroken or Broken Glass: One of the most common issues, specifically in high-traffic locations, is split or broken glass. Regular maintenance is crucial for the longevity and efficiency of industrial windows. Ignoring these tasks can cause more significant and pricey repairs down the line. Here are some essential upkeep practices:

The procedure of commercial window repair typically involves a number of steps:
